Abstract
为减小环境温度变化对通信中长周期光纤光栅(LPFG)器件谐振波长的影响,文章设计了一种补偿谐振波长漂移的方案,即在光栅表面涂覆一层随温度升高折射率变大的薄膜。计算结果表明,该方案是可行的,实现了谐振波长的零漂移,在通信领域具有广阔的应用前景
